A biomimetic reaction between β, β′-diamenoketones (eg kynuramine, kynurenine or o, o′-diaminobenzophenone) and a variety cyclohexanediones and quinones leading to pyrido [2, 3, 4-kl) acridines is described. The synthesis of several di-and tetrahydro-pyrido [2, 3, 4-kl) acridine derivatives (7, 10. 12 and 15) as well as benzoderivatives of the marine alkaloids eilatin (1) and ascididemin (2), compounds 28 and 30, has been accomplished. ...
